Style 

The first thing to consider while buying yourself a wig is its style. You need to decide on the look that you want to opt for. Wigs come in hundreds of styles. While some people like styling their wig just like their natural hair, others do not mind experimenting. 

As a first-time buyer, we recommend choosing a wig style similar to your original hair. For those who still want to keep experimenting with different hairstyles, a hand-tied wig is the best option.

Cap Construction 

After deciphering the style of the wig, the next step involves choosing the right cap construction. If you want to wear your hair away from your face, a lace front wig is the best choice for you. This cap construction lets you style your hair in the way you want. Always choose a lace-front wig that comes with a non-slip poly strip.

Another sought-after option is headband wigs. They are easy to wear and versatile.

Material 

One of the biggest questions that may come to your mind while shopping for a wig is the wig's material. They are usually made using different materials.  Human hair and synthetic wigs are the two most popular types.

When compared to synthetic wigs, human hair wigs are superior. They are made using natural hair, thus making them feel and appear like your real hair. Human hair may cost you a little more, but worth all your money. Nowadays, you can also explore a variety of human hair machine wigs

Cap Size 

Buying a wig in the right cap size can be a little confusing for all first-time buyers. Capsize comes in different types, such as child/petite, petite/average, large, and others.

If you are buying a wig online, we advise you to measure your head and follow the size guide to understand your capsize. If you are buying it offline, the expert will help you choose a suitable size.

Maintenance 

Last but not least, do not overlook the maintenance that your wig demands. Different types of wigs come with varied maintenance instructions. Maintaining a short wig is easier as opposed to a long wig. 

Ensure that you maintain your wig properly to use it in the long run. The best tip of all is not wearing the same wig every day.
